For this reason, we have created a new series ... Web15 nov. 2024 · The soybeans then go into an oven to reach a temperature of 60 and 88° C (140–190 °F). They tumble down a conveyor belt so they can be crushed into whole soybean flakes. The flakes are allowed to cool slightly, at least to 69 °C (156 °F), and then mixed with hexanes to extract the lecithin. Web14 okt. 2024 · Soy beans are first soaked in water and then ground into a paste. This paste is combined with more water and boiled. The soy milk is then strained and can be flavored or sweetened before being packaged. A half gallon of soy milk generally contains between 60-80 soy beans. How Many Soybeans Are In 1 Gallon Of Milk? Web4 apr. 2024 · Soy wax is vegetable wax derived from the oil of soybeans and is primarily used in candles. After they are harvested, the soy beans are cleaned, cracked, de-hulled, and rolled into flakes. It is from these flakes that the oil is extracted to then be hydrogenated. Web16 nov. 2024 · Epoxidized soybean oil (ESO) is the oxidation product of soybean oil with hydrogen peroxide and either acetic or formic acid obtained by converting the double bonds into epoxy groups, which is non-toxic and of higher chemical reactivity.
